This is a presentation by Dada Robert in a Your Skill Boost masterclass organised by the Excellence Foundation for South Sudan (EFSS) on Saturday, the 25th and Sunday, the 26th of May 2024.
He discussed the concept of quality improvement, emphasizing its applicability to various aspects of life, including personal, project, and program improvements. He defined quality as doing the right thing at the right time in the right way to achieve the best possible results and discussed the concept of the "gap" between what we know and what we do, and how this gap represents the areas we need to improve. He explained the scientific approach to quality improvement, which involves systematic performance analysis, testing and learning, and implementing change ideas. He also highlighted the importance of client focus and a team approach to quality improvement.

Published classroom materials form the basis of syllabuses, drive teacher professional development, and have a potentially huge influence on learners, teachers and education systems. All teachers also create their own materials, whether a few sentences on a blackboard, a highly-structured fully-realised online course, or anything in between. Despite this, the knowledge and skills needed to create effective language learning materials are rarely part of teacher training, and are mostly learnt by trial and error.
Knowledge and skills frameworks, generally called competency frameworks, for ELT teachers, trainers and managers have existed for a few years now. However, until I created one for my MA dissertation, there wasn’t one drawing together what we need to know and do to be able to effectively produce language learning materials.

2. About the Department
The Department of Commerce was established in 1971.
Offers Commerce Education to arround 1100 students at UG and PG Level.
Offers five courses at UG level and one at PG level.
Courses offered:
Courses Offered Level Year of
Commencement
Nature Student Intake
M.Com.(Finance) PG 1980 University 40
B.Com.(Regular) UG 1971-72 University 70
B.Com.(Taxation) UG 1994-95 Self-finance 70
B.Com.(Computers) UG 2002-03 Self-finance 90
B.Com.(Honours) UG 2005-06 Self-finance 90
B.Com. (Business Analytics) UG 2019-20 Self-finance 70
3. Course – Modus Operandi :
Semester system for UG & PG
Choice Based credit system for UG & PG
Internship & Project work for UG courses (Internship has been made
optional for students admitted from 2018 onwards)
Continuous assessments through internal tests and end semester
examinations
4. About Courses :
B.Com.(Regular): Started in 1971-72, offers commerce course as prescribed
by the university.
B.Com.(Taxation): Started in 1994-95, offers specialized education in the
discipline of taxation to equip students with nuances of Income tax.
B.Com.(Honours): Started in 2005, offers advanced commerce education to
inculcate a higher understanding of commerce suitable for pursuing .
B.Com.(Computers): Started in 2002-03, offers commerce education
integrated with ICT skills.
B.Com.(Business Analytics): Started in 2019-20, offers commerce education
integrated with impacting skills on Data Analysis and Data Analysis
Software.
